Housing permits decline in Washington for second year in a row

Summary by MY Northwest
For those who are looking to purchase a new home, you might have to wait, as housing permits have dropped in the state of Washington for the second consecutive year. A new study of 384 metro areas by Point2, an international real estate search portal, found that permitting activity in Washington plummeted in 2023.
